## Ownership

This directory holds the search relevance tuning notes for Larkmoor Search. Includes synonym maps, boost weights, and the evaluation harness configs. Do not edit weights in production without running the offline eval suite first. On-call: for relevance regressions, check the tuning log here before rolling back. All changes require sign-off from the maintainer listed below.

account owner for bawip-tahag: Raleth Quenok

- [ ] **Step 7: Breaker override escrow.** After sealing the signing keys for the Tallgrove upstream API circuit breaker, confirm the support team can force the breaker open during a full outage. The override bundle lives in the sealed escrow drawer and is useless without its unlock phrase. Two ceremony witnesses must initial this step before proceeding. The escrow bundle is decrypted with the recovery passphrase that follows.

vault phrase of kahip-kahop = holath-quenmir

Quarterly Planning Note — Northvale Region Sales Review

Sales leads: Q3 closed 4% under target, driven mainly by slow uptake of the Arclight bundle in the Dunmere territory. Renewals held steady at 91%. For Q4, we're reallocating two field reps to Harrowgate and trimming the discount ceiling to 10%. Pipeline reviews move to biweekly; come prepared with stage-by-stage numbers, not summaries. Forecast templates go out Monday. The confidential note on our wider plans appears below.

internal memo for fajog-yagaf: Gross margin on Ulaael came in at 20 percent against a plan of 10 percent. Only 9 of the 80 pilot accounts renewed Ulaael, so a churn review is set for July 1.